Jonathan Berger – Using Art to Understand the Mind



What can art, including music, reveal about how the mind works? How does cognitive science study the human capacity for, and experience of, music? How to tease apart the elements of music: rhythm, melody, harmony, dynamics, tone color, etc., and how are all the elements integrated into a coherent, flowing whole? How can art help us understand the mind?
